Dubai: The Ministry of Energy and Infrastructure convened the first Executive Technical Roundtable of the Global Energy Efficiency Alliance (GEEA) during Middle East Energy 2026, bringing together senior government officials, corporate leaders, technology providers, and financial institutions to accelerate the implementation of practical and scalable energy efficiency solutions.
According to Emirates News Agency, the high-level roundtable, held under the theme 'Moving Energy Efficiency from Commitments to Action,' focused on translating energy efficiency ambition into implementation through innovative technologies, pilot projects, financing mechanisms, and stronger collaboration between governments, industry, and financial institutions. The event presented GEEA's vision and growing international implementation agenda, providing participating companies the opportunity to share innovative technologies, implementation case studies, and pilot projects capable of delivering measurable energy efficiency improvements.
Discussions also explored opportunities for technology validation, collaborative pilot projects, financing solutions, and implementation partnerships that could support wider deployment across participating countries. Sharif Al Olama, Undersecretary for Energy and Petroleum Affairs at the Ministry of Energy and Infrastructure, emphasized that energy efficiency is a strategic imperative for strengthening energy security and supporting sustainable economic growth.
Led by the Ministry of Energy and Infrastructure, GEEA is a government-led, implementation-focused alliance established to help bridge the gap between global energy efficiency commitments and practical action. It brings together governments, industry, financial institutions, technology providers, international organizations, and academia to accelerate the deployment of practical and scalable solutions.
The roundtable highlighted the role of the GEEA digital platform in supporting continued collaboration beyond the event. This platform enables participating governments and partners to share implementation experiences, innovative technologies, policy knowledge, financing solutions, and best practices. Participants explored future collaboration through GEEA's technical workstreams, pilot projects, and international implementation initiatives, with a focus on identifying practical opportunities that can progress from technical dialogue towards validation, demonstration, and wider deployment.
Through GEEA, the UAE aims to strengthen the connection between policy ambition, technology, finance, and implementation, helping transform global energy efficiency commitments into practical projects and measurable outcomes that contribute to energy security, economic competitiveness, climate action, and sustainable development.
